S&T Bancorp Inc (STBA)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 10.01% as of December 2025.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. S&T Bancorp,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for S&T Bank that provides retail and commercial banking products and services to consumer, commercial, and small businesses in Pennsylvania and Ohio. It accepts time and demand deposits; originates commercial and consumer loans; and cash management, brokerage, and trust services, as well as act as guardian of employee benefits.
